Kendam Press Launches Exciting New Series Featuring Charlie Wags
Exciting Launch of 'The Tales of Charlie Wags'
Kendam Press is thrilled to introduce a delightful new picture book series that is sure to captivate young readers. 'The Tales of Charlie Wags: New York City' is the inaugural book authored by the talented sister duo, Ali Barclay and Sofie Wells. This engaging story is tailored for children aged 3–7 and features Charlie, a lovable dog whose wagging tail allows him to embark on enchanting adventures.
Charlie's Adventures in NYC
In this first exciting journey, Charlie takes young readers on a tour of the vibrant streets of New York City. Throughout the story, children will encounter iconic landmarks including the Statue of Liberty, the Empire State Building, and the renowned Broadway. The narrative adds an extra layer of fun as Charlie stops at a classic New York pizzeria, enjoying the flavors of the city. After an eventful day filled with exploration, Charlie returns home to dream of his next adventure, making readers eager for what’s to come.
The Perfect Combination of Learning and Fun
This series is thoughtfully crafted to bring the excitement of the world’s greatest cities to life for children. Each book in the series is written in lively, rhyming verses that engage young readers and encourage them to read aloud with their parents. Beautiful digital watercolor illustrations by the acclaimed Sanna Sjöström enhance the storytelling experience, bringing energy and charm to Charlie's travels.
The book features a whimsical map and a paw print trail that illustrates Charlie's journey, promoting real-world exploration alongside imaginative play. To enrich the reading experience further, the conclusion of the story includes "Paws and Learn: Landmarks Unleashed," a special two-page spread that invites children to discover fascinating historical facts and stimulate meaningful discussions.
A Global Perspective from the Authors
Ali Barclay and Sofie Wells are inspired by their global heritage, which includes family roots in various countries. Their background instilled a deep appreciation for cultural diversity and the educational benefits of travel. Through Charlie's adventures, they wish to bring the magic of exploration to children everywhere.
"We recognize that not every child can travel the world firsthand, but picture books can offer glimpses into different cultures and places," explain the authors. "They provide kids the chance to explore new environments and foster a sense of curiosity from their homes. Being daughters of immigrants, we learned early on about the richness of cultural experiences, which inspired us to create this series dedicated to instilling a love for travel and learning among families.”

Anticipated Future Adventures
Readers can look forward to more of Charlie's adventures in upcoming titles such as 'The Tales of Charlie Wags: London' and 'The Tales of Charlie Wags: Paris', along with a festive 'European Christmas Adventure'. Each story will continue to inspire curiosity and connection through delightful narratives and stunning illustrations.
